Are you a Data Analyst interested in working for a leading charity

St Mungos is undertaking a major data strategy project aimed at cultivating a datadriven culture where every team and department is empowered to leverage data effectively in their decisionmaking processes aligning with the organisations overall objectives. This initiative will enable St Mungos to prioritise data usage in highimpact areas driving greater value and efficiency across the charity.

As part of this data strategy project the Data Analyst will join the IT team to play a vital role in providing actionable insights derived from data to enhance decisionmaking. By utilising accurate and timely data the Data Analyst will help leadership make informed decisions reducing reliance on intuition and guesswork and ensuring that our strategy and aims are grounded in datadriven insights.

Through the analysis of operational data the Data Analyst will identify inefficiencies and areas for improvement enabling St Mungos to streamline processes reduce costs and enhance performance. Other key responsibilities will include:

  • Translate technical data into actionable insights and prepare reports summarizing key findings and recommendations.
  • Create Power BI dashboards to present complex data in a clear format for diverse stakeholders.
  • Build and maintain data pipelines and models to ensure accurate efficient data across systems.
  • Collaborate with analysts DBAs and stakeholders to align datadriven insights with business goals.
  • Develop processes to capture analysis requirements define objectives and assess data sources.
  • Support data quality and compliance through validation and audit reporting.
  • Recommend improvements for business processes and data workflows to optimise performance.
  • Drive continuous improvement by adopting new tools industry trends and best practices.

About you

We think this role will suit someone who can utilise their communication skills alongside data analyst experience to help improve a data driven culture across the organisation. If you see yourself in this role you should demonstrate the below:

  • Experience of working in a Data Analyst or similar post with proven skills in the use of structured query language (SQL) for querying and manipulating data stored in databases leveraging advanced MS SQL skills for data extraction and manipulation.
  • Expertise in data analysis using Power BI and experience with Python programming language.
  • Experience in data visualisation to deliver actionable insights and statistical models to represent data trends forecasts and relationships.
  • Knowledge and experience of ETL processing; extracting data from various sources cleaning transforming it into a usable format and loading it into analysis tools.
  • Excellent communication skills with the ability to work across different teams and levels of the organisation and to translate complex data for a variety of people including nontechnical stakeholders.

About Us

Our purpose is to end homelessness and rebuild lives. It drives everything that we do. For the past 55 years we have been on the ground every day and every night supporting people to recover from homelessness and advocating for change. We support around 28000 people each year and our work means that more than 2700 people have somewhere safe to stay each night.
